One of the most important of Japanese poets of the period from 1930–1960, Nishiwaki revolutionized the poetry of Japan, introducing surrealist-like passages and the juxtaposition of images. His greatest work, The Modern Fable (1953) translated here by Hiroaki Sato, returned to more common Japanese techniques, while creating a kind of discourse between East and West, the ancient and modern, and concretism and abstraction.
